<div> An <strong> SEO Content Contractor </strong> at Logical Media Group will be responsible for various digital marketing activities, primarily focused on creating and developing strategy for copy with Search Engine Optimization (SEO) best practices in mind in order to boost visibility of client marketing efforts and Logical Media Group internal marketing efforts, particularly in search engine ranking for projects as assigned. This will include site research, keyword research, content development, optimization, and performance analysis for our clients. <br/> <br/> <strong> <strong> Requirements <br/> <br/> </strong> </strong> <strong> Deliverables <br/> <br/> </strong> <ul> <li> Content Creation: Creating and strategizing high-quality, SEO-optimized content for both Logical Media Group and our external clients target audiences. Responsible for writing 15-20 pieces of optimized keyword-rich SEO content based on variety of industries, topics, trends, and valuable industry updates which should be tailored to search engines and provide high value to targeted audiences. </li> <li> Keyword research: Use keyword research and content strategies for targeting and ranking for high-volume keywords </li> <li> Optimization: Post optimized articles and/or optimized content following industry standards to our CMS platform, social channels and more. Optimize current copy, landing pages and metadata for maximum organic exposure and conversions while maintaining engaging targeted content </li> <li> Edit: Provide oversight of SEO content written by team members by editing and optimizing per SEO best practices </li> <li> Reporting: Outline key insights and takeaways from reports and other tools such as Google Analytics and Google Search console. Effectively articulate results of recommended optimizations and initiatives and formulate next steps accordingly (whether positive or negative) <br/> <br/> <br/> </li> </ul> <strong> Strategy & Project Management <br/> <br/> </strong> <ul> <li> SEO Content Strategies: Craft SEO Content strategies and provide proactive recommendations for clients tailored to their unique goals, strengths, and challenges. Prioritize initiatives by impact and ease of implementation </li> <li> Deliverable Timelines: Formulate timelines for key deliverables. Delegate and assign deadlines for key deliverables to supporting team members. </li> <li> Cross-Team Communication and Strategy: Work cross-functionally with web, paid, and creative teams to ensure on-time delivery of initiatives and cohesive digital strategy. </li> <li> Account Monitoring: Monitor monthly retainer and project hours to ensure the client receives maximum value for retainer without significantly overspending on hours <br/> <br/> <br/> </li> </ul> <strong> <strong> Additional Responsibilities <br/> <br/> </strong> </strong> <ul> <li> Continued learning: Keep up-to-date with and proactively research news and trends in SEO, content, analytics, trending topics, etc. and share with the team </li> <li> Business development: Identify opportunities for and pitch clients on up-sells to aid in the growth of SEO Content business </li> <li> Team training: Help train SEO Content support staff on basic management initiatives and setup tasks <br/> <br/> <br/> </li> </ul> <strong> <strong> Requirements <br/> <br/> </strong> </strong> <ul> <li> Basic knowledge of SEO and how it applies to Content marketing </li> <li> Experience with tools such as Google Analytics, Google Search Console, SEMRush </li> <li> Expertise in creative writing incorporating SEO best practices, critical analysis, and editing skills </li> <li> Understanding of and experience in local search optimization </li> <li> Understanding of basic HTML as it relates to SEO </li> <li> Ability to implement foundational SEO recommendations in a Wordpress environment </li> <li> Ability to apply best practices and content strategy on various social media platforms (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, Youtube, etc.) </li> <li> Excellent analytical, organizational, project management and time management skills </li> <li> Attention to detail and ability to effectively manage multiple clients and deadlines simultaneously </li> <li> Bachelor's Degree in relevant fields such as english, journalism, Communication, Marketing, etc. </li> <li> At least 3 years of experience in writing for online publications <br/> <br/> <br/> </li> </ul> <strong> <strong> Benefits <br/> <br/> </strong> </strong> Logical is an Equal Opportunity Employer. A: My approach to keyword research starts with understanding the target audience and their search intent. I utilize tools like SEMRush and Google Keyword Planner to identify high-volume keywords relevant to the client's industry. I also analyze competitors' keywords and consider long-tail variations to capture niche markets. The goal is to create a list of keywords that not only drive traffic but also align with the content strategy and client's goals.

A: I focus on key metrics such as organic traffic, bounce rate, average session duration, and conversion rates. Using t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console, I assess which content performs well and which doesn’t. I leverage these insights by identifying patterns in successful content to replicate those strategies in future projects. For instance, if data shows that longer articles generate more traffic, I might recommend creating more in-depth pieces on similar topics.
